In today's fast-paced technological landscape, businesses are constantly seeking ways to enhance their operations and improve efficiency. One of the critical processes involved in achieving these goals is systems implementation, which refers to the process of deploying and integrating new software or technology systems within an organization. This process is essential for ensuring that the systems function effectively and meet the specific needs of the business. Understanding the intricacies of systems implementation can significantly impact a company's success in adopting new technologies.The first step in systems implementation is the planning phase. During this stage, organizations must assess their current systems, identify gaps, and determine the requirements for the new system. This involves gathering input from various stakeholders, including employees, management, and IT professionals. By involving all relevant parties, companies can ensure that the new system will address the real needs of the organization. A well-thought-out plan lays the foundation for a successful systems implementation.Once the planning is complete, the next phase is the design and development of the system. This stage may involve customizing existing software or creating a completely new solution tailored to the organization's needs. Effective communication between the development team and the stakeholders is crucial during this phase to ensure that the system aligns with the business objectives. Additionally, it is vital to establish a timeline and budget for the systems implementation process to avoid any potential delays or cost overruns.After the design and development phase, the organization moves on to the testing phase. Here, the new system undergoes rigorous testing to identify any bugs or issues that need to be resolved before deployment. This stage is critical, as it helps ensure that the system is reliable and functions as intended. User acceptance testing (UAT) is often conducted during this phase, allowing actual users to provide feedback on the system's performance. Addressing any concerns raised during UAT is essential for a smooth transition during the systems implementation.Following successful testing, the next step is the deployment of the new system. This phase involves rolling out the system across the organization and ensuring that all employees are trained to use it effectively. Training sessions should be comprehensive and tailored to different user groups to maximize adoption and minimize resistance to change. A well-executed training program is a key factor in the success of systems implementation.Once the system is live, the organization must focus on ongoing support and maintenance. This includes monitoring the system's performance, addressing any issues that arise, and implementing updates as necessary. Continuous improvement is vital for the long-term success of the system and the organization as a whole. Organizations should also gather feedback from users to identify areas for enhancement and ensure that the system continues to meet their needs.In conclusion, systems implementation is a multifaceted process that requires careful planning, design, testing, deployment, and ongoing support. By understanding and mastering the various stages of systems implementation, organizations can successfully integrate new technologies and improve their operational efficiency. As businesses continue to evolve, the ability to adapt and implement new systems effectively will remain a critical factor in achieving sustainable growth and success.
